Vital Statistics at Time of Disappearance

  • Missing Since: June 15, 2008 from Shepherd, Texas
  • Classification: Involuntary
  • Date Of Birth: January 26, 1941
  • Age: 67
  • Height: 5'4"
  • Weight: 120 lbs.
  • Hair Color: Grey/balding
  • Eye Color: Blue
  • Race: White
  • Gender: Male
  • Distinguishing Characteristics: Wears glasses,
    he has dentures but rarely wears them, surgery scar on
    right side of his neck, surgery scars on right leg,
    right leg underdeveloped compared to left due to childhood
    illness (Osteomylitis)causing an obvious limp, brown birthmark
    on back of one of his legs, scar on one of his hands.
  • Medical Conditions:Had a stroke several years ago.
    Balance and ability to walk impaired causing a limp. He takes
    medications for heart problems, angina and panic disorder.
  • Clothing: He tends to wear black velcro tennis shoes,
    denim jeans, plaid colored, short sleeved, western shirts
    with pearl snap buttons.
  • Jewelry: Watch


  • Details of Disappearance
    Walter's sons went to visit hime for Father's Day. They found his van was in driveway, but no answer at the door. They went to next door neighbors who had a set of keys to his home. No sign of Walter was found in the house and he was promptly reported as missing. Authorities returned Mon. June 16, 2008 continued to search to no avail, made arrangements for local VFD and Equusearch to proceed with air, ATV and foot search of the area, however turned up nothing.
